How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Communications Technologies & Support from Ai Atlanta Cost?

$19,354 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Ai Atlanta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Ai Atlanta paid an average of $535 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$19,260 $19,260
Fees $94 $94
Books and Supplies $600 $600

Ai Atlanta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Communications Technologies & Support

30 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
16.7% Women
80.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 30 bachelor’s degrees in communications technologies and support hand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in communications technologies and support in 2019-2020, 16.7% of them were women. This is less than the nationwide number of 43.6%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 80.0% of the communications technologies and support bachelor’s degrees at Ai Atlanta in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 42%.
